Who We’re Looking For

Toyota Financial Services is on a mission to modernize how data is sourced, stored, and used across our global ecosystem. We’re looking for a strategic and hands‑on Manager of Data Engineering to lead the vision, design, and implementation of our enterprise-wide data acquisition and ingestion platform—powering everything from analytics to AI and Data Products in a Business Domain.

What You’ll Be Doing
  • Lead the design, and execution of a modern, scalable data acquisition and analytical platform to ingest data from internal systems, APIs, microservices, and third‑party sources.
  • Design, Build robust production-grade pipelines and self‑service tools that enable software and data engineers to acquire data at scale—securely and efficiently.
  • Architect cloud-native lake and lakehouse solutions (AWS, Snowflake) and implement multi-tenant capabilities to serve global Toyota entities.
  • Partner across business, product, data architecture, and platform teams to deliver an integrated, governed, and discoverable data ecosystem.
  • Define and champion data engineering best practices: data modeling, schema evolution, data contracts, testing strategies, lineage tracking, cataloging, and governance
  • Proactively communicate technical risks, tradeoffs, and recommendations to both engineering and non-technical stakeholders
  • Collaborate closely with Engineering Managers, Product, Data Science, and Analytics to shape data roadmaps and ensure the platform evolves with business needs
  • Design and implement data quality frameworks — validation rules, anomaly detection, freshness checks, and alerting — so downstream consumers can trust the data without asking
  • Identify and resolve systemic data issues: pipeline failures, data quality degradation, schema drift, latency in streaming systems, cost inefficiencies in storage and computing, and gaps in data observability
  • Lead and grow a high-performing team of 6+ engineers, setting a high bar for technical depth, delivery, and innovation.
What You Bring
  • 10–15+ years in data engineering and platform tech leadership roles.
  • Hands‑on experience with enterprise‑scale data acquisition methods (CDC, APIs, file transfer, event streaming).
  • Deep knowledge of cloud‑based lake/lakehouse architectures (AWS, Redshift, Snowflake, or similar).
  • Strong programming skills (Python or Java) and experience with microservices and APIs.
  • Proven ability to design and implement scalable, secure, and governed data platforms.
  • Exceptional communication skills, with the ability to align business and technical stakeholders.
